Ingredients
-
0.25 cup Quest Protein Powder, Multi-Purpose Mix
1 serving Bob's Red Mill Almond Flour - per 1/4 Cup
16 gram(s) Bob's Red Mill - Organic High Fiber Coconut Flour (7g / Tbsp) (by SCHNELLD)
1 serving gelatin unflavored powder ~ knox 1/2 tsp 1.6g (by BMAKEDA)
6 gram(s) Bob's Red Mill - Chia seeds - 1Tbsp=13g
0.125 tsp Cream Of Tartar
.75 tsp Baking Soda
1 large Egg, fresh, whole, raw
.125 cup Yogurt Plain Greek Yogurt, non-fat
.5 serving Almond Milk Silk Pure Unsweetened all natural original 30 calories/1cup
.0625 cup Applesauce, unsweetened
Directions
Mix all dry. Mix wet separately in a larger bowl. Add dry to wet ingredients. Heat pan on medium heat. Spray generously with non-stick spray. Scoop about 1/3 cup of batter onto the pan, 3 min on first side, about 2 on the second. Serve with fresh or frozen fruit, or with sandwich fixings.
Serving Size: Makes 4-5 4-inch pancakes
